Transaction 61bcd104b42396d0847829b5d150a6521c2f515d1fa269fe2658cb1b4eaee2ec
1 Input
1 Output
-
61bcd104b42396d0847829b5d150a6521c2f515d1fa269fe2658cb1b4eaee2ec:0
- value
- 546837372
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f6ba6eb3c59cf347e1eab4f07fc92ee2ca51aad
- address
- ltc1qfa46d6eut88ngls74d8s0lyjack22x4d6tjkgs